Transaction 8536c6c0266b780fd5b30bac0860e1866d59bcabff74bf8e5bad625f449ab30f

block
2ce19a5cf3ca87ce006f0ea87c9e93b7eb3806e25c381cda13b358891916ceb7

26 Inputs

2 Outputs